颅内HPC的MRI影像学特征研究

摘要

目的探讨颅内血管外皮细胞瘤 (HPC)的磁共振成像(MRI)影像学特征。 方法 选取2013年1月至2018年1月在我院 治疗的HPC患者23例(HPC组),同时选取 血管瘤型脑膜瘤患者70例作为对照(脑 膜瘤组),比较两组MRI影像学特征。结 果 23例HPC中,经病理诊断14例为高分 化HPC,9例为间变性HPC;HPC组肿瘤形 态呈分叶状、肿瘤坏死囊变、瘤体呈窄 基底附着硬膜、T2WI呈等高信号、肿瘤 明显强化比例分别为65.22%、69.57%、 65.22%、73.91%和91.30%,高于脑膜瘤 组(P<0.05);间变性HPC肿瘤坏死囊 变比例为100.00%,高于高分化HPC(P <0.05);高分化HPC和间变性HPC在肿 瘤形态、硬膜尾征、肿瘤与附着硬膜关 系、T1WI信号、T2WI信号和肿瘤强化程 度方面差异无统计学意义(P>0.05)。结 论 颅内HPC的MRI影像表现具有一定特征 性,且不同分化HPC的MRI影像表现有一 定差异。

Objective To investigate the imaging features of magnetic resonance imaging (MRI) of intracranial hemangiopericytoma (HPC). Methods From January 2013 to January 2018, 23 HPC patients (HPC group) were treated in our hospital, and 70 patients with hemangioma meningioma were selected as the control group (meningioma group), two groups of MRI imaging features were compared. Results In 23 cases of HPC, 14 cases were high differentiation HPC, 9 cases were anaplastic HPC. The lobulated tumor morphology, tumor necrosis and cystic degeneration, tumor showed narrow basement attach to the dura, T2WI showed equal high signal, tumor enhancement ratio in HPC group were 65.22%, 69.57%, 65.22%, 73.91% and 91.30%,were higher than that of meningioma group (P<0.05), the ratio of tumor necrosis and cystic degeneration in anaplastic HPC was 100.00%, higher than the high differentiation HPC (P<0.05), the difference in tumor morphology, dural tail sign, the relationship between tumor and attachment dura, T1WI signal, T2WI signal and the degree of tumor enhancement between anaplastic HPC and high differentiation HPC were no statistical significant (P>0.05). Conclusion The MRI image of intracranial HPC has some characteristic features, and there are certain differences in the MRI image of different differentiated HPC.

前言

颅内血管外皮细胞瘤(hemangiopericytoma,HPC)临床较为少见, 因其与脑膜瘤具有相似MRI影像学特征,故而本病术前定性诊断较为困 难[1]。但由于颅内HPC血运较为丰富,术中出血较难控制,导致无法完 全切除肿瘤,进而增加肿瘤转移和复发的概率,因而,术前颅内HPC的 早期诊断显得具有重要意义。影像学检查是术前诊断颅脑HPC的主要方 法[2],但目前对MRI多功能成像在HPC诊断中的研究尚不全面。故而, 本研究深入探讨了颅内HPC的MRI影像学特征,旨在为临床颅内HPC的诊 断提供参考,现报道如下。
